BODY
{
margin-top:0px;
margin-bottom:0px;
margin-left:0px;
margin-right:0px;
background:#454545;
}

.cent
{
text-align:center;
}

a.bottomNav
{
height:14px;
font-family:tahoma;
font-weight:bold;
font-size:10px;
color:#454545;
display:block;
padding-top:5px;
padding-bottom:5px;
padding-left:10px;
padding-right:10px;
background:#DAD6C0;
text-decoration:none;
border-right-width:8px;
border-right-color:#454545;
border-right-style:solid;
}

a.bottomNav:hover
{
color:#FFFFFF;
background:#9F9A7D;
}

.h20
{
height:20px;
}

img
{
border:0px;
}

.mainTable
{
width:943px;
background:#454545;
}

.centralCol
{
width:799px;
}

.centralTable
{
width:799px;
}

.mainBox
{
//width:783px;
width:943px;
border-color:#DAD6C0;
border-width:8px;
border-style:solid;
background:#FFFFFF;
}

.h8grey
{
height:8px;
background:#454545;
}

.footerCell
{
padding:11px;
height:130px;
background:#DAD6C0;
}

.leftfade
{
background-image:URL('tigihairproducts/leftthin.gif');
}

.rightfade
{
background-image:URL('tigihairproducts/rightthin.gif');
}

.blackback
{
background:#1F1A17;
}

.wholeTable
{
width:100%;
}

.wholeTable2
{
width:965px;
background:#1F1A17;
}

.blacktop
{
height:176px;
background:#1F1A17;
}

.border40
{
width:40%;
}

.fade
{
height:324px;
background-image:URL('tigihairproducts/fade.gif');
}

.navBox
{
border-top-width:11px;
border-top-style:solid;
border-top-color:#FFFFFF;
border-right-width:8px;
border-right-style:solid;
border-right-color:#FFFFFF;
border-left-width:11px;
border-left-style:solid;
border-left-color:#FFFFFF;
}

.h8
{
height:8px;
background:#FFFFFF;
}

.h5
{
height:5px;
background:#FFFFFF;
}

h1
{
margin:0px;
}

.beautyWhite
{
font-weight:bold;
font-size:11px;
font-family:tahoma;
color:#FFFFFF;
padding:5px;
}

.beautyWhitePrice
{
font-weight:bold;
font-size:12px;
font-family:tahoma;
color:#FFFFFF;
padding:5px;
}

.navCell
{
padding-left:8px;
height:20px;
width:173px;
//background:#CECDCC;
background:#8D8D8D;
}

.navCell2
{
height:23px;
width:173px;
background:#9F9A7D;
}

.navCell3
{
height:15px;
width:173px;
background:#DAD6C0;
}


.h1lightgrey
{
height:1px;
width:173px;
background:#EBEAEA;
}

.sep1
{
border-top-width:11px;
border-top-style:solid;
border-top-color:#FFFFFF;
background:#EBEAEA;
width:1px;
}

.displayBox
{
border-top-width:11px;
border-top-style:solid;
border-top-color:#FFFFFF;
border-right-width:11px;
border-right-style:solid;
border-right-color:#FFFFFF;
border-left-width:8px;
border-left-style:solid;
border-left-color:#FFFFFF;
width:671px;
}

.thumbnail
{
width:131px;
border-color:#F4F3EC;
border-width:3px;
border-style:solid;
background:#FFFFFF;
height:10px;
}

.w8
{
width:10px;
background:#FFFFFF;
}

.productText
{
height:100px;
padding-top:3px;
width:137px;
font-family:tahoma;
font-size:9px;
color:#6A6965;
}

.productText h1
{
font-family:tahoma;
font-size:9px;
color:#6A6965;
margin:0px;
}

.productPrice
{
padding-top:7px;
width:137px;
font-family:tahoma;
font-size:9px;
font-weight:bold;
//color:#F1BE44;
color:#D19300;
}

.productHeader
{
width:137px;
font-family:tahoma;
font-size:9px;
color:#454545;
}

A.navLink
{
padding-top:3px;
display:block;
height:30px;
font-family:tahoma;
font-size:10px;
font-weight:bold;
color:#FFFFFF;
text-decoration:none;
}

A.navLink:HOVER
{
font-family:tahoma;
font-size:10px;
font-weight:bold;
color:#EF007F;
text-decoration:none;
}

A.navLink2
{
margin:0px;
display:block; 
padding-top:6px;
padding-left:8px;
font-weight:bold;
font-family:tahoma;
font-size:10px;
color:#FFFFFF;
text-decoration:none;
height:18px;
width:168px;
}

A.navLink4:HOVER
{
color:#FFFFFF;
background:#EF007F;
}

A.navLink4
{
margin:0px;
display:block; 
padding-top:6px;
padding-left:12px;
padding-right:12px;
font-weight:bold;
font-family:tahoma,arial,sans-serif;
font-size:9px;
color:#666666;
text-decoration:none;
height:18px;
/* width:65px;*/
}

.w10
{
width:10px;
}

.assistantHeader
{
font-size:14px;
font-weight:bold;
}

.assistantHeaderB
{
font-size:14px;
font-weight:bold;
color:#F9CA39;
}

.day
{
font-size:12px;
font-weight:bold;
color:#FFFFFF;
background:#3A3430;
padding-left:5px;
padding-right:25px;
padding-top:5px;
padding-bottom:5px;
}

.time
{
font-size:11px;
font-weight:bold;
color:#B6B6B6;
padding-left:5px;
padding-right:25px;
padding-top:5px;
padding-bottom:5px;
}

a.boldLink
{
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
font-weight:bold;
text-decoration:none;
}

a.boldLink:hover
{
text-decoration:underline;
}

.w722
{
width:1800px;
}

A.navLink2:HOVER
{
color:#FFFFFF;
background:#EF007F;
}

A.navLink3
{
margin:0px;
display:block; 
padding-top:5px;
padding-left:8px;
font-weight:bold;
font-family:tahoma;
font-size:10px;
color:#000000;
text-decoration:none;
height:15px;
width:168px;
}

A.navLink3:HOVER
{
color:#FFFFFF;
background:#EF007F;
}

.h1white
{
height:1px;
background:#FFFFFF;
}

.h21white
{
height:21px;
background:#FFFFFF;
}

.h3
{
height:3px;
}

.productHeader2 h1
{
font-family:tahoma;
font-size:11px;
color:#454545;
margin:0px;
}

.headNav
{
text-align:right;
background:#1F1A17;
float:right;
}

.indivCell
{
height:300px;
}

.logoBlock
{
background:#1F1A17;
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
font-weight:bold;
}

.dropDown
{
background:#DAD6C0;
width:100%;
}

.footerText
{
font-family:tahoma;
font-size:10px;
color:#444444;
width:600px;
}

.footerText2
{
font-family:tahoma;
font-size:10px;
color:#444444;
text-align:right;
}

.browseLink
{
font-family:tahoma;
font-size:10px;
color:#444444;
text-decoration:none;
}

A.browseLink
{
font-family:tahoma;
font-size:10px;
color:#444444;
text-decoration:none;
}

A.browseLink:HOVER
{
font-family:tahoma;
font-size:10px;
color:#000000;
text-decoration:underline;
}

.footerLink
{
font-family:tahoma;
font-size:10px;
color:#444444;
text-decoration:none;
}

A.footerLink
{
font-family:tahoma;
font-size:10px;
color:#444444;
text-decoration:none;
}

A.footerLink:HOVER
{
font-family:tahoma;
font-size:10px;
color:#000000;
text-decoration:none;
}

.w8grey
{
width:8px;
background:#454545;
}

.w346green
{
background:#9F9A7D;
}

.mainTableB
{
background:#1F1A17;
}

.searchInput
{
width:173px;
font-family:tahoma;
font-size:10px;
color:#454545;
}

.h67black
{
height:67px;
background:#1F1A17;
}

.logoCell
{
width:262px;
background:#1F1A17;
}

.shoppingCell
{
width:537px;
height:70px;
background:#1F1A17;
}

.basketText2
{
text-align:right;
font-family:tahoma;
font-size:10px;
color:#FFFFFF;
font-weight:bold;
}

.numText
{
font-family:tahoma;
font-size:9px;
color:#FFFFFF;
}

.buttonPad
{
padding-top:10px;
}

.squarePad
{

padding-left:18px;
width:1px;
}

.subnavPad
{
height:8px;
}

.productImage
{
width:722px;
border-color:#F4F3EC;
border-width:3px;
border-style:solid;
background:#FFFFFF;
}

.productImage2
{
width:300px;
border-color:#F4F3EC;
border-width:3px;
border-style:solid;
background:#FFFFFF;
padding:10px;
}

.productImage6
{
width:722px;
border-color:#000000;
border-style:solid;
background:#1F1A17;
}
.productImage3
{
width:722px;
border-color:#000000;
border-width:3px;
border-style:solid;
background:#1F1A17;
}

.productImage5
{
width:722px;
background:#1F1A17;
}

.productImage4
{
width:300px;
border-color:#000000;
border-width:3px;
border-style:solid;
background:#1F1A17;
padding:10px;
}

.productImage7
{
	width:722px;
	border-color:#000000;
	border-width:3px;
	border-style:solid;
	background-color: #FFFFFF;
}
.productHeader2
{
font-family:tahoma;
font-size:11px;
color:#454545;
}

.productText2
{
padding-top:3px;
font-family:tahoma;
font-size:11px;
color:#51504E;
}

.productPrice2
{
font-family:tahoma;
font-size:14px;
font-weight:bold;
color:#F1BE44;
}

.productImageCell
{
width:250px;
height:250px;
}

.h11
{
height:11px;
}

.mainHeader
{
padding-left:5px;
background:#DAD6C0;
height:20px;
font-family:tahoma;
font-size:11px;
font-weight:bold;
color:#FFFFFF;
}

.breadCrumbs
{
font-family:tahoma;
font-size:11px;
font-weight:bold;
color:#454545;
}

A.breadCrumbs
{
font-family:tahoma;
font-size:11px;
font-weight:bold;
color:#454545;
text-decoration:none;
}

A.breadCrumbs:HOVER
{
font-family:tahoma;
font-size:11px;
font-weight:bold;
color:#454545;
text-decoration:underline;
}

.brandText
{
font-family:tahoma;
font-size:9px;
color:#454545;
}

.inputPrice
{
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
font-family:tahoma;
color:#686868;
font-size:11px;
width:100px;
}

.inputNum
{
font-family:tahoma;
color:#686868;
font-size:11px;
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
width:30px;
}

.inputBox
{
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
font-family:tahoma;
color:#686868;
font-size:11px;
width:200px;
}

.keyword
{
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
font-family:tahoma;
color:#767676;
font-size:11px;
width:140px;
}

.searchPad
{
padding-left:3px;
}

.inputBoxPost
{
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
font-family:tahoma;
color:#686868;
font-size:11px;
width:250px;
}

.inputBoxL
{
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
font-family:tahoma;
color:#686868;
font-size:11px;
width:240px;
}

.inputBox3
{
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
font-family:tahoma;
color:#686868;
font-size:11px;
width:200px;
height:40px;
}

.inputName
{
font-family:tahoma;
color:#686868;
font-size:11px;
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
width:154px;
}

.inputTitle
{
font-family:tahoma;
color:#686868;
font-size:11px;
border-width:1px;
border-color:#CCCCCC;
border-style:solid;
}

.buttons
{
float:right;
}

.spacer1
{
border-top-width:10px;
border-top-style:solid;
border-top-color:#FFFFFF;
border-bottom-width:10px;
border-bottom-style:solid;
border-bottom-color:#FFFFFF;
height:21px;
background:#DAD6C0;
}

.h40
{
height:40px;
}

.promoCell
{
width:400px;
padding-left:20px;
}

.promoHeader
{
font-family:tahoma;
font-size:12px;
color:#F9CA39;
font-weight:bold;
}

.promoHeader2
{
font-family:tahoma;
font-size:12px;
color:#F9CA39;
font-weight:bold;
padding:5px;
}

.newsHeaderblue
{
font-family:tahoma;
font-size:18px;
color:#75C4F0;
font-weight:bold;
}

.newsHeader
{
font-family:tahoma;
font-size:18px;
color:#F9CA39;
font-weight:bold;
}

.news1
{
font-family:tahoma;
font-size:12px;
color:#75C4F0;
font-weight:bold;
text-align:center;
}

.news2
{
font-family:tahoma;
font-size:12px;
color:#BFA161;
font-weight:bold;
text-align:center;
}

.news3
{
text-align:center;
}

.news4
{
font-family:tahoma;
font-size:12px;
color:#75C4F0;
font-weight:bold;
text-align:left;
}

.news5
{
font-family:tahoma;
font-size:12px;
color:#BFA161;
font-weight:bold;
text-align:left;
}

.promoHeader2
{
font-family:tahoma;
font-size:12px;
color:#F9CA39;
font-weight:bold;
padding-top:20px;
}

a.promoLink
{
font-family:tahoma;
font-size:11px;
color:#F9CA39;
font-weight:bold;
text-decoration:none;
}

a.promoLink:hover
{
text-decoration:underline;
}

.genHeader
{
font-family:tahoma;
font-size:11px;
color:#454545;
font-weight:bold;
}

.genTxt
{
font-family:tahoma;
font-size:11px;
color:#6A6965;
}

A.genTxt
{
font-family:tahoma;
font-size:11px;
color:#6A6965;
text-decoration:none;
}

A.genTxt:HOVER
{
font-family:tahoma;
font-size:11px;
color:#6A6965;
text-decoration:underline;
}

.genTxt2
{
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
}

.genTxt3
{
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
}

.genTxt3:HOVER
{
font-family:tahoma;
font-size:11px;
color:#EF007F;
text-decoration:underline;
}

A.genTxt2
{
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
text-decoration:none;
}

A.genTxt2:HOVER
{
font-family:tahoma;
font-size:11px;
color:#FFFFFF;
text-decoration:underline;
}

.productHeader3
{
background:#1F1A17;
width:722px;
color:#FFFFFF;
height:14px;
font-family:tahoma;
font-weight:bold;
font-size:10px;
}

.bolder
{
font-weight:bold;
}

.italic
{
font-style:italic;
}

.blackonwhitetitle
{
font-family:tahoma;
font-size:15px;
font-weight:bold;
color:#000000;
background:#FFFFFF;
padding:5px;
width:110px;
}

.blackonwhite
{
font-family:tahoma;
font-size:12px;
color:#000000;
background:#FFFFFF;
padding:5px;
width:110px;
}
.stylistPic
{
border-color:#605A57;
border-style:solid;
border-width:5px;
}

.beautyTreatment
{
font-family:tahoma;
font-size:14px;
font-weight:bold;
color:#EF007F;
background:#1F1A17;
padding:5px;
width:200px;
}

.treatmentG
{
font-family:tahoma;
font-size:11px;
font-weight:bold;
color:#FFFFFF;
background:#1F1A17;
padding:5px;
width:200px;
}

.treatmentGd
{
font-family:tahoma;
font-size:14px;
font-weight:bold;
color:#EF007F;
background:#1F1A17;
padding:5px;
width:200px;
}

.treatmentGHeader
{
font-family:tahoma;
font-size:12px;
font-weight:bold;
color:#EF007F;
background:#1F1A17;
padding:5px;
width:110px;
}

.treatmentGb
{
font-family:tahoma;
font-size:12px;
font-weight:bold;
color:#FFFFFF;
background:#1F1A17;
padding:5px;
width:110px;
}

.treatmentGc
{
font-family:tahoma;
font-size:11px;
color:#EF007F;
background:#1F1A17;
padding:5px;
}

.treatmentB
{
font-family:tahoma;
font-size:11px;
font-weight:bold;
color:#FFFFFF;
background:#1F1A17;
padding:5px;
width:200px;
}

.treatmentBd
{
font-family:tahoma;
font-size:14px;
font-weight:bold;
color:#0094DE;
background:#1F1A17;
padding:5px;
width:200px;
}

.treatmentBHeader
{
font-family:tahoma;
font-size:12px;
font-weight:bold;
color:#0094DE;
background:#1F1A17;
padding:5px;
width:110px;
}

.treatmentBb
{
font-family:tahoma;
font-size:12px;
font-weight:bold;
color:#FFFFFF;
background:#1F1A17;
padding:5px;
width:110px;
}

.treatmentBc
{
font-family:tahoma;
font-size:11px;
color:#0094DE;
background:#1F1A17;
padding:5px;
}

.pricingSub
{
font-family:tahoma;
font-size:10px;
font-weight:normal;
color:#FFFFFF;
}
.prod_cat_bed_sfact_text 
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
	background-color: #FFFFFF;
}
